This firm must predate my pipe smoking days by 20 years, but the only
suggestion I have is that you should contact the Jewish Community of
Istanbul, as this is clearly a Hebraic name. As it is a very close-knit
community, it should not be hard to track down Hayim Pinhas or his
family if he is deceased. Be aware that Pinhas is usually a first name
(Ataturk made Jews adopt Turkish family names, so that Pinhas is not a
typical Turkish Jewish surname - it does exist as a surname in other
communities, though), so that the principal of the firm could also be
known by his actual family name, with Pinhas being a middle name.
However, I am sure that you will get a response to any message looking
for a pipemaker/exporter named Hayim Pinhas. Just do a web search for
Jewish Community Istanbul; send an E-mail to the webmaster of web pages
that may look like they are official or semi-official. The Turkish
Jews, like all Turks, are very warm and will be only too happy to help
you especially as even non-pipe smokers take pride in the national
craft of meerschaum pipemaking. Who knows - you may even get a response
from a fellow meerschaum smoker.
